The purpose of pupil assignment laws was to?

History
1 answer:
alexgriva [62]3 years ago
3 0

A. Integrate public schools.

Explanation:

All through the primary portion of the twentieth century, there were a few endeavors to battle school segregation, and yet very little was effective. So the Pupil Assignment Act piece of legislation established by the lawmaking body of North Carolina in 1955 which tried to defer the racial integration of the public schools.

Since Integrated education brings youngsters and staff from Catholic and Protestant conventions, just as those of different beliefs, or none, together in one school and also it become a boon success.

It was passed before the Pearsall Plan. In any case, in a consistent 1954 choice in the Brown v. leading group of Education case, the United States Supreme Court ruled isolation in segregation in public schools unconstitutional.

What are the components of the low-risk drinking guidelines for women aged 18-65?
algol [13]

The components of the low-risk drinking guidelines for women aged 18-65 are  Drinking no more than 3 standard drinks on one occasion and Drinking no more than 7 standard drinks per week.

Those who consume alcohol at unsafe or harmful amounts at a higher chance of developing diseases like cancer, obesity, high blood pressure, stroke, injury, diabetes, and cirrhosis.

The amount of alcohol one consume each day and the frequency of high drinking days also matter. That is why government come up with guidelines for women safety. specially for pregent women. Guideline are for the women of aged 18 to 65.
